Measurements
We measure sound intensity (also referred to as sound power or sound pressure) in units called decibels. An audiometer is a device that measures how well a person can hear certain sounds.
Wind effect
Refraction is the change in direction of a wave. Wind affects the propagation of sound by refracting its waves. Therefore, a person standing downwind of a sound source hears higher levels of sound, while a person standing on the opposite end will hear lower sound levels.
